Luxurious Self-Sufficient Eco Lodge in Africa Is Designed To Give Back

Italy-based design firm MASK Architects has created a unique eco-safari in Africa that will give back to the surrounding communities. Passionate about the fact that clean water should not be a luxury commodity, MASK Architects has designed modular lodges that produce its water supply using Air to Water technology. Visitors will be welcomed to the luxury resort knowing that their needs, as well as the needs of the local community, are being taken care of.

Blind and Neurodivergent Teen Pianist Performs for King Charles III at Coronation Concert

A once-in-a-lifetime musical talent deserves the biggest stage they can get, and for one teen prodigy, this meant a royal celebration. Lucy Illingworth, a 13-year-old blind and neurodivergent pianist, first marveled the world a few months ago. Her performance of a Chopin nocturne on a piano in a train station in Leeds shocked the judges of the British talent show The Piano, and moved passersby to tears.
